sayang

English dictionary entry

Meanings

noun
  1. love
  2. sweetheart, darling
verb
  1. to love, adore
  2. to regret, to miss (regret the absence of)
  3. to soothe
  4. to call someone by an affectionate nickname such as 'darling'
adj
  1. pitiful, regrettable
intj
  1. alas, what a pity!

Pronunciation

/ˈsaɪ.jaŋ/ /ˈsa-/ /ˈsa.jɑŋ/

Word forms

sayang more sayang most sayang

Etymology

* (Singaporean and Malaysian English): Borrowed from Malay sayang. * (Philippine English): Borrowed from Tagalog sayang.
